^(60)Co-γ射线外照射对猫血液学的影响

摘要 猫受^(60)Co—γ射线外照射后,导致血象、骨髓象及细胞化学明显改变。此变化与照射剂量有一定的依存关系,且有很强的时间性。3Gy以上剂量照射,导致造血系统的严重损伤,7~10d即发生正细胞正色素性贫血;1~2 Gy剂量照射,导致造血系统中等度损伤。血细胞对射线的敏感性,依次为淋巴细胞、粒细胞、血小饭、红细胞;骨髓细胞对射线的敏感性,依次为红细胞系统、粒细胞系统、巨核细胞系统,非造血系统细胞对射线不敏感。细胞化学中,DNA变化明显,而PAS、POX、NAP变化不明显,由此认为,DNA可作为放射损伤早期诊断的参照指标。 ^(60)Co irradiation induced significant changes of blood and bonemarrow pictures and cytochemistry. The changes were related to irradiativedose and time. The cats given more than 3Gy developed serious damage ofhemopoietic system and normocytic and normochromic anemia occurred after7-10 days. The moderate damage of hemopoietic system occurred in catsgiven 1-2Gy. Lymphocyte, granulocyte, thrombocyte, erythrocyte in bloodand erythroid, myeloid, megakaryocytoid cells in bone marrow cells, in theorder named, were more sensitive to ^(60)Co irradiation. The DNA was consi-dered to be a reference indicator for the early diagnosis of irradiation da-mage.
